PyDocs is a modern, open-source documentation site for learning Python from scratch to advanced topics. It is built with Astro and Starlight, and organized by key themes for easy navigation and contribution.
PyDocs is an innovative, open-source platform designed to facilitate the learning of Python programming from the ground up. Whether you're a complete novice or looking to polish advanced skills, PyDocs covers all essential aspects of Python, making it an invaluable resource for aspiring developers. With a sleek and user-friendly interface, it offers a wide range of topics structured clearly with practical exercises to reinforce learning.
The platform's engaging and supportive community further enhances its appeal, offering multilingual documentation in both English and Spanish, ensuring accessibility for a global audience. It stands out not only for its comprehensive content but also for its modern design and navigational efficiency, making the learning experience not just educational but also enjoyable.
Astro is the all-in-one web framework designed for speed. Pull your content from anywhere and deploy everywhere, all powered by your favorite UI components and libraries.
Starlight is a full-featured documentation theme built on Astro. It provides beautiful, fast documentation sites with built-in search, internationalization, SEO optimization, and accessibility features out of the box.
Tailwind CSS is a utility-first CSS framework that provides pre-defined classes for building responsive and customizable user interfaces.
Documentation themes are built specifically for writing technical and product documentation. They are normally written and maintained in Markdown. The often include a navigation menu, search bar, clear headings, semantic document structure and clean typography.